Microsoft and Cray on Tuesday unveiled CX1, a compact, competitively priced supercomputer that the companies said they developed jointly for customers who perform tasks such as simulations that require compute-intensive environments.
Cray’s CX1 computer runs Windows HPC (High Performance Computing) Server 2008 and is available for customers to order now [...]

Sony Ericsson Xperia phones may not use Windows in future
Future Sony Ericsson phones launched under its new Xperia brand may not be based on Microsoft Windows, the handset maker said at the launch of its digital marketing campaign for the Xperia X1 on Monday.
The X1, which will be the premium phone in Sony Ericsson’s portfolio when it starts shipping later this month, is Sony [...]

Xbox 360 Price Drop is Official in Europe
Microsoft have officially announced their new, lower prices for all three currently available SKUs starting Friday, the 19th of September .
The new prices start at £129.99, unsurprisingly, for the Arcade, £169.99 for a 60GB hard-drive and single wireless controller and a bargain £229.99 for the 120GB-endowed Elite… which isn’t sounding so Elite now we have [...]
